WHAT YOU CAN DO- Manage all areas of Club Accounting for the Whitetail Club and support all club members with questions regarding their billings.
- Post daily revenue journal and daily bank transactions. This position will be responsible for resolving any out of balance and guest dispute issues.
- Reconcile relevant bank accounts in Great Plains.
- Reconcile Sales Tax return against source documents and research variances.
- Reconcile and properly document all Balance Sheet accounts. This includes monthly reconciliation of bank accounts and daily reconciliation of the key hotel accounts (City Ledger, Advance Deposits, etc.)
- Post month‑end journal entries as needed.
- Prepare and post other adjusting journal entries as required by the Director of Finance.
- Prepare account reconciliations as required.
- Work with Director of Finance to support with research and resolution of P&L line‑item variances.
- Participate in Accounting meetings as scheduled.
- Complete assignments and special projects assigned by Accounting Management.
